Analysis

In 2023, completion rate, primary education, rural, both sexes in Senegal stood at 42.1%. That is the highest value across all 11 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 15.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, completion rate, primary education, rural, both sexes in Senegal peaked at 42.1% in 2023 and was at its lowest, 10.5%, in 2005.

That places Senegal 75th out of 84 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the bottom qu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 11 years of available data.

Completion rate, primary education, rural, both sexes in Senegal, year by year

Annual values for Completion rate, primary education, rural, both sexes (%) in Senegal, 2000 to 2023.
Year % Change
2000 14.7%
2002 17.5% +18.6%
2005 10.5% -39.7%
2011 25.1% +138.1%
2014 36.5% +45.3%
2015 38.3% +5.0%
2016 36.5% -4.7%
2017 37.5% +2.7%
2018 38.3% +2.3%
2019 34.5% -9.9%
2023 42.1% +22.1%
